The Sacramento Kings sign Doug McDermott for the 2024/25 season

You can always use more three-point shots.

According to ESPN's Shams Charania, the Sacramento Kings have signed three-point specialist and veteran forward Doug McDermott to a one-year deal.

McDermott, 32, is a 10-year NBA veteran who has a career three-point shooting rate of 41 percent on 3.5 attempts per game.

The Kings had to address their lack of frontcourt depth after the recent trade that sent Jalen McDaniels to San Antonio, and now they have a 6-foot-2 wing to move into the secondary alongside Malik Monk, Kevin Huerter and Trey Lyles can integrate head coach Mike Brown's unit,
